Output 63bda49dc6604ccf29b2cde14d39d348a57cb883420b1fb8b816d88c9c2c9b59:0

value
6012976
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 86b93e545041e50546735db8b50b0de0674dd46c OP_EQUALVERIFY OP_CHECKSIG
address
1DHMTeZArsSN7VS5w14qhUeZzP4hwCBbn5
transaction
63bda49dc6604ccf29b2cde14d39d348a57cb883420b1fb8b816d88c9c2c9b59
spent
true